Project 1 Name: Abdallah Tariq Bashawri ID: 201000514 Subject: Pre Calculus Section: 105 Due: 1st march,2013

Original: y=x shift 2 units up y=x+2 shift 2 units down y=x-2 reflex –x reflex with shift up 2 units y=-x+2 reflex with shift down 2 units y=-x-2

Original: y=x^2 shift 3 units up y=x^2+3 shift 4 units down y=x^-4 reflex –x^2 reflex with shift up 3 units y=-x^2+3 reflex with shift down 4 units y=--x^-4

Original: y= abs x shift 3 units up y=abs x+3 shift 3 units down y=abs x-3 reflex –abs x reflex with shift up 3 units y= - abs x+3 reflex with shift down 3 units y=-abs x-3

Original: y=sqrt x shift 3 units up y=sqrt x+3 shift 4 units down y= sqrt x-4 reflex sqrt -x reflex with shift up 3 units y=sqrt –x+3 reflex with shift down 4 units y= sqrt-x-4

Original: y=2^x shift 4 units up y=2^x+4 shift 3 units down y=2^x-4 reflex –2^x reflex with shift up 4 units y=-2^x+4 reflex with shift down 3 units -2^x-3

Original: y=1/x shift 2 units up y=1/x+2 shift 3 units down y=1/x-3 reflex –1/x reflex with shift up 2 units y=-1/x+2 reflex with shift down 3 units -1/x-3

Original: y=x^3 shift 4 units up y=x^3+4 shift 5 units down y=x^3-5 reflex –x^3 reflex with shift up 4 units y=-x^3+4 reflex with shift down 5 units y=-x^3-5
